Hollyoaks star Anna Passey has opened up about her long-distance relationship with her former co-star Nick Rhys.
Anna, who has played Sienna Blake on the Chester-based soap for the past six years, met Nick when he played Lockie Campbell between 2014-16.
He then left to appear in TV mini-series Harley and the Davidsons and Holby City, and is currently pursuing new roles in the U.S.

Anna, 33, admitted their romance is more complicated now than when they were co-stars but they are making it work.
“We’ve been together getting on for five years now. Nick’s in Los Angeles at the moment so it’s rather a long-distance relationship,” she told What’s On TV.

“It’s not always easy with him on the other side of the world but that’s often what you get when you date another actor. Maybe I should have chosen a plumber or something – only joking!”
Anna previously told the publication that one benefit of him no longer working with her is she doesn’t have to watch him getting passionate with her friends!

When asked how she felt about Nick’s kissing scenes in Hollyoaks, she said: “In every interview I have ever read with actors and actresses, they always say it’s not weird because it’s a job, but I find it so bizarre, especially as Lockie is making out with everybody all the time – these are my pals in the show.
“Jennifer [Metcalfe, who plays Mercedes] will come up to me and say, ‘I’ve been kissing your boyfriend all morning’.”

Sienna and Nick aren’t the only ones to have found love in real life thanks to Hollyoaks.
Daisy Wood-Davis and Luke Jerdy, who play Kim Butterfield and Jesse Donovan, are a happy couple who live together with their cat.

Meanwhile Nadine Mulkerrin and Rory Douglas-Speed, who play Cleo McQueen and Joel Dexter, revealed their romance at the end of 2017.
